He was the son of William Archie and Ora (Gooding) Williams. Reb married Rosemary Doolin on August 29, 1953, in Emerald Grove, Wisconsin. He was formerly employed as an operating engineer by Beloit Pipe and Dredge and Arby's Construction. He was a member of Local #139 Operating Engineers and the Morning Coffee Club at East Point Restaurant. Reb had a love of playing cards, hunting with John Thurow and cooking. Dad loved being with family and friends and loved telling jokes. He had a big heart and will be truly missed. He enjoyed watching car races, the Atlanta Falcons and Atlanta Braves. Reb is survived by his daughter, Judy (Larry) Stall of Milton; his sons, Richard Williams of Huntington, IN, and Ronnie Williams of Janesville; grandchildren: Melanie Stall of Evansville, Phillip Stall of Milton, Autumn (Mike) Davis of Janesville, Collin Williams of Hobe Sound, FL, and Kasey (Chris) Mundt of Stuart, FL; brothers: Gene (Pat) Williams, Leaston (Gertrude) Williams, and Calvin Williams, all of Georgia; many nieces, nephews and special friends. He was preceded in death by his wife, Rosemary on April 9, 2006. Also preceding him in death were his parents; sisters: Elouise Luke, Louise Howell, and Leona Cole; brothers, Jeff Williams and Bruce Williams; and a grandson, Kyle Williams.
